Product Information

4-Biphenylboronic acid is a versatile compound widely utilized in organic synthesis and materials science. Known for its ability to form stable complexes with various substrates, this boronic acid derivative is particularly valuable in Suzuki coupling reactions, which are essential for the formation of carbon-carbon bonds in the synthesis of complex organic molecules. Its unique structure allows for effective participation in cross-coupling reactions, making it a preferred choice for researchers in pharmaceuticals and agrochemicals looking to develop new compounds with enhanced properties.

Additionally, 4-Biphenylboronic acid is recognized for its role in sensor technology, where it can be employed in the detection of biomolecules and environmental pollutants. Its ability to interact selectively with diols makes it suitable for applications in biosensors and chemical sensors, providing a reliable method for monitoring various analytes. With its broad range of applications and effectiveness in facilitating complex reactions, 4-Biphenylboronic acid stands out as a crucial reagent for both academic research and industrial applications.

Synonyms
Biphenyl-4-boronic acid(Contains varying amounts of anhydride), 4-Phenylphenylboronic acid(contains varying amounts of anhydride)
CAS Number
5122-94-1
Purity
≥ 99% (HPLC)
Molecular Formula
C12H11BO2
Molecular Weight
198.03
MDL Number
MFCD00093311
PubChem ID
151253
Melting Point
232 - 245 ?C
Appearance
Off-white solid
Conditions
Store at RT

Applications

4-Biphenylboronic acid is widely utilized in research focused on:

  • Organic Synthesis: This compound serves as a key reagent in the Suzuki-Miyaura cross-coupling reaction, enabling the formation of carbon-carbon bonds, which is essential for creating complex organic molecules.
  • Pharmaceutical Development: It is used in the synthesis of various pharmaceuticals, particularly in the development of antitumor agents and other therapeutic compounds, enhancing drug efficacy and specificity.
  • Material Science: The compound plays a role in the development of advanced materials, such as polymers and nanomaterials, due to its ability to form stable complexes with various substrates.
  • Bioconjugation: Its boronic acid functionality allows for selective binding to diols, making it useful in bioconjugation techniques for labeling biomolecules, which is crucial in diagnostics and research.
  • Environmental Applications: 4-Biphenylboronic acid is explored for use in sensors that detect environmental pollutants, providing a means to monitor and mitigate contamination effectively.
